Toyota released a completely redesigned Cressida for the 1985 model year. However, a knock-sensor was added to the 5M-GE engine for the 1985 model year. This sensor recognized pre-ignition and modified timing accordingly when lower-grade gasoline was used. The body style was completely different from prior versions, being bigger and more aerodynamic.

How much horsepower does a 1983 Ford Cressida have?
Its engine capacity was increased to 2.8 liters (168 cubic inches) and was fuel-injected, resulting in a rating of 116 horsepower. That was sufficient, but the 1983 engine received a twin overhead cam, which resulted in an increase in horsepower to 143 hp (156 hp in the 1984-88 Cressida). This was impressive considering the engine’s modest size.

What engine does a 1986 Toyota Cressida have?
The fifth-generation Cressida, which was offered in the United States for the 1985 through 1988 model years, shared a lot of its chassis and running-gear architecture with the Toyota Supra. This one is powered by the 5M-GE engine, which produces 156 horsepower. One more horse than the available V8 in the much heavier 1986 Chevrolet Caprice car, which is a significant improvement.
What engine does a 1983 Toyota Cressida have?
This vehicle is powered by a 2.8-liter inline-6 engine with 143 horsepower. It is designated as the ″5M-GE″ in the name. It drives the rear wheels with a four-speed automatic gearbox that is controlled electronically. The debut year for this DOHC engine was 1983, and it replaced an older SOHC engine that produced around 30 less horsepower at the time.

How many liters is a 22R engine?
The 22R, a 2-valve SOHC engine with a displacement of 2.4 L (2,366 cc), was built from 1981 until 1997. The size and stroke of the cylinder were 92 mm and 89 mm, respectively (3.62 in and 3.50 in).

What is a Toyota Cressida?
The 1973 Cressida was a mid-sized sedan that competed with Mercedes, Volvo, and other ″import″ automobiles. It was exclusively available in Japan; it was exported from the country in 1977, and it continued to be manufactured as the Cressida until 1992. (continuing under other names continued into the 21st century).
Is Toyota Cressida a good car?
THE Cressida is a strong, well-built, and dependable vehicle that has experienced few difficulties. However, it is now an old automobile, and old cars, no matter how fantastic they were when they were new, are more prone to breakdowns. Most Cressidas have more than 200,000 kilometers on the odometer, which means you’re getting a used car that is towards the end of its useful life.
